Handover: ElevAtor Simulator, v2.4 cut.

Done: hall-call batching merged, soak test passed 48h. Open: idle-parking heuristic still flaps under the Tower-C scenario — tracked, not a blocker per Marisol. Release notes drafted, need your sign-off. Feature flag `elevator.batch_dispatch` must stay off for the Kestrel tenant until their config migrates. Canary plan: 5% for 24h, then full rollout if dispatch latency p95 stays under 400ms. Rollback is one flag flip. Checklist and flag ownership table are on the internal page below.

dashboard of yafog-fajof = https://jira.tolvaqsys.internal/pages/pages/projects/49fe21c4

# Restricted: Brellan Partners Term Sheet (Managers Only)

Prepared for the board.

Brellan's draft term sheet proposes a minority stake with board observer rights, a two-year exclusivity window in the Ostvale market, and staged payments tied to milestones. Counsel flags the exclusivity clause as overly broad. Our recommended negotiating position is set out below.

confidential, kagep-kahof: Druokax Systems plans to lower the Ulaath list price by 53 percent in March.

Handover: per-tenant rate quotas (Meridock gateway)

Quotas are enforced at the edge via token buckets keyed by tenant ID. Overrides for the three large tenants expire end of quarter — don't renew without product sign-off. Burst config is touchy; test in staging first. The quota table and change process are documented internally.

operations page: https://confluence.tolvaqsys.corp/spaces/pages/pages/6e787158f507